Ascension Day Worship – May 21, 2020
On Thursday, May 21, 2020 we celebrate Ascension Day. This principal feast marks the time when Christ rises to heaven after appearing to his followers for 40 days. Our Ascension Day service features prayers, music, and a homily by our Rector, the Rev. Joseph H. Hensley, Jr. You can view the service leaflet here.
